During the final of the European men’s handball championships, which saw Denmark triumph over Germanythe Queen stole everyone’s show: between screams, hands in hair and waving scarves, her “ultra” version drove her compatriots crazy.

Mary of Denmark unleashed in the stands

The line between royalty and common people disappears when sport is involved. During the fiery final of the European Handball Championships between Denmark and Germany in Herning, Mary of Denmark lived every minute of the match with a rare intensity for a member of the royal family. While his national team was fighting for the European title (then won with a clear 34-27), the Queen has been through a real rollercoaster of emotions.

The photos showing her with her head in her hands during moments of tension or while proudly waving a scarf with the writing “Danmark” they tell of a woman who lives sport with the same determination as her subjects.

A “Patriotic Chic” look to copy

Even in the fan version, Mary did not give up a touch of absolute class, interpreting the colors of the Danish flag in a glamorous way. For the evening she chose an outfit that expertly mixed luxury brands and refined garments: a red ikat print shirt by La Bagatelle combined with black trousers and dark ankle boots.

But what made the difference were the accessories: a couple of Gucci eyeglasses with an intellectual-chic flavor and a bag Hugo Boss fiery red coordinated. A perfect mix of patriotism and style that made her radiant even under the lights of the sports hall.

«Can I hug them?»: the sweet backstory

The most talked about moment, however, came after the final whistle. While Denmark celebrated winning the European gold, Queen Mary took to the field for the awards ceremony. According to the Danish media, in the throes of enthusiasm, Mary asked coach Nikolaj Jacobsen a very sweet question: «Can I hug the players?». Once the green light was obtained, the sovereign held the champions close to her, congratulating them on the performance, which was then described on official social media as “absolutely fantastic”.
